Description

MS4078 is an anaplastic lymphoma kinase (ALK) PROTAC (degrader) based on Cereblon ligand, with a Kd of 19 nM for binding affinity to ALK[1].

In Vitro

MS4078 effectively inhibits cancer cell proliferation. MS4078 (10-3, 10-2.5, 10-2, 10-1.5, 10-1, 10-0.5, 1 μM; 3 days) concentration-dependently inhibits proliferation of SU-DHL-1 cells with an IC50 of 33±1  nM. In comparison with SU-DHL-1 cells, the proliferation of NCI-H2228 cells is less sensitive to MS4078(10-2, 10-1.5, 10-1, 10-0.5, 1, 100.5 μM; 3 days)[1].
MS4078 potently reduces the ALK fusion protein levels and inhibits the ALK auto-phosphorylation and down-steam STAT3 phosphorylation in both SU-DHL-1 and NCI-H2228 cells in a concentration-dependent manner. In SU-DHL-1 cells, MS4078 reduces the NPM-ALK protein levels with impressive DC50 (50% degradation) value of 11±2 nM after 16-hour treatment. Over 90% of inhibition of both ALK Y1507 and STAT3 Y705 phosphorylation is achieved at the 100 nM concentration. In NCI-H2228 cells, MS4078 reduces the EML4-ALK protein levels with similar DC50 value of 59 ± 16 nM after 16-hour treatment. At the 100 nM concentration, NCI-H2228 cells reduces more than 90% of EML4-ALK protein levels[1].

Cell Viability Assay[1]

Cell Line: SU-DHL-1 and NCI-H2228 cells
Concentration: 10-3, 10-2.5, 10-2,10-1.5, 10-1, 10-0.5, and 1 μM for SU-DHL-1  cells; 10-2, 10-1.5, 10-1, 10-0.5, 1, 100.5 μM for NCI-H2228 cells
Incubation Time: 3 days
Result: Inhibited proliferation of SU-DHL-1 cells (IC50=33 ± 1 nM). Less sensitive to the proliferation of NCI-H2228 cells than SU-DHL-1 cells.

Western Blot Analysis[1]

Cell Line: SU-DHL-1 and NCI-H2228 cells
Concentration: 1, 3, 10, 30, and 100 μM for SU-DHL-1 cells; 3, 10, 30, 60, and 100 μM for NCI-H2228 cells
Incubation Time: 16 hours
Result: Reduced the NPM-ALK protein levels with impressive DC50 of  11 ± 2 nM in SU-DHL-1 cells. Reduced the EML4-ALK protein levels with similar DC50 of 59 ± 16 nM in NCI-H2228 cells
